Lewis PURINGTON was born 8 August 1815 in Gorham, Massachusetts (District of Maine)

Lewis PURINGTON was the child of Daniel PURINGTON   and   Nancy CROCKETT and the grandchild of: (paternal)  David Abijah PURINGTON and Sarah DAVIS (maternal)  Peter CROCKETT and Mary "Polly" WARREN

Spouse(s)/Partner(s) and Child(ren):

Lewis  married  Eliza PARKS 1 March 1844 .  The couple had (at least) 1 child.
Eliza PARKS  was born 28 November 1825 in New Brunswick, Canada.  Eliza died 7 May 1914 in New Brunswick, Canada. 

Lewis PURINGTON died 22 July 1899

Did You Know?The name Maine is probably a practical nautical term which refers to the region being a mainland (separate from the many surrounding islands). Reference to the area as 'Maine' in writing first appeared in 1622. (statesymbolsusa.org)

Prior to 1685 - New England
1686 - 1689 - Dominion of New England
1690 - 1775 - New England
1776 - 1820 - Massachusetts (District of Maine)
March 15, 1820 - Maine becomes 23rd U.S. state
